Looking for your next project? This will suit handsomely as it will require much renovation work – a spacious 2 Bedroomed Mid Terrace House situated in a popular residential area of Caernarfon, being within easy reach of town centre amenities, schools and leisure facilities.
A spacious traditional Mid Terrace House situated in a popular residential area of Caernarfon, being within easy reach of town centre amenities, schools and leisure facilities. The property will require extensive renovation works and should therefore be considered as a project for those who like DIY or have the required skills – if you’re an investor or first time buyer that’s up for the challenge then this could be right up your street. The interior offers a decent sized living room with feature open fireplace and the kitchen is of a decent size too. 2 bedrooms reside on the first floor with one in particular being of a good size and both served by a bathroom. Externally, to the rear is a private enclosed yard with steps and gate leading to the rear service lane. The property comes fitted with uPVC double glazing and back boiler heating (located behind the fireplace).

The property is conveniently located in a popular residential neighbourhood in the Twthill district, close to the centre of the historic town of Caernarfon, offering a wide range of shops, most essential services, schools and leisure facilities. With its excellent surrounding road network, the town is also well placed for the many coastal and rural attractions to found in this part of North Wales.

Dafydd Hardy Estate Agents and Chartered Surveyors are an employee-owned, independent business with 5 offices covering Gwynedd, Anglesey, and Conwy. Having won numerous prestigious awards, the company was founded by Dafydd Hardy and Richard Thomas (both RICS Chartered Surveyors) in 1992. Today, it is a trusted and successful enterprise in North Wales, celebrated for its expertise and extensive experience in residential sales, lettings, surveys, and commercial property matters.
